Anybody travelling to Greece for this tournament. avoid XL Airways.
I was in Greece for a week with my girlfriend, then decided to travel to France, and the XL flight had to crash land at Brindisi airport in Italy.
The cabin pressure dropped at 38,000 feet. So the pilot had to decend to 10,000 rapidly. Some oxygen masks came down, some didn't. Why?
Mine didn't, but luckily we didn't seem to need them.
The pilot lowered the landing gears to cause drag so he could burn off some fuel to make it safe to land. This caused a fault with one of the wheels and we had to land on back two wheels and the belly of the plane.
Well done to the pilot...
But why is this not on the news, why was there a gash in the air conditioning pipe, and why didn't my oxygen mask come down?
AVOID XL AIRWAYS.
